How to Choose the Perfect Outdoor Shade
Selecting the right outdoor shade involves more than just picking a color. Consider the primary use: are you shading a dining area, a lounging spot, or a beach excursion? For dining, a larger umbrella with a tilting mechanism offers flexibility, while for lounging, a cantilever or offset umbrella provides unobstructed coverage. Also, think about the sun’s path in your yard—a rotating umbrella can be a game-changer. Finally, assess the wind conditions in your area; a sturdy base is non-negotiable for safety and longevity.
Understanding Umbrella Sizes and Coverage
Size matters when it comes to shade. Measure your space to ensure the umbrella fits without overwhelming the area. A 9-foot umbrella typically covers a standard dining table (seats 4-6), while a 10-foot or larger is better for bigger tables or seating groups. For beach or fishing, portability and coverage are key—an octagonal umbrella offers more shade than a round one of the same diameter. Always check the canopy diameter and the height to ensure it clears your head and provides adequate coverage.
Materials: Durability and Maintenance
The frame material dictates the umbrella’s strength and weight. Aluminum is lightweight and rust-resistant, ideal for residential use. Steel is heavier and more durable, perfect for windy areas, but it requires a powder coating to prevent rust. For the canopy, polyester is a popular choice due to its UV resistance and water repellency. Look for a high thread count and a UV protection rating. For bases, steel or resin-filled bases offer stability; choose a base that matches the umbrella’s size and your surface (e.g., a rolling base for portability).

Care Tips to Extend the Life of Your Shade
Proper maintenance ensures your investment lasts. Always close the umbrella when not in use, especially during strong winds, to prevent damage. Clean the canopy with mild soap and water, and let it dry completely before storing to prevent mildew. For bases, wipe down metal parts to avoid corrosion, and store them indoors during winter if possible. Lubricate moving parts like tilt mechanisms annually. With regular care, your outdoor shade will provide comfort for years to come.
